923. News: Vipps launches Apple Pay rival, Zopa Bank tells us about its big raise, and Goldman backs out of climate agreement

Join host Benjamin Ensor alongside some very special guests as we look at the biggest financial services and fintech stories of the past week.Topics covered include: Norway’s Vipps MobilePay becoming the first company in the world to offer a competing option to Apple Pay on iPhones; Goldman Sachs withdrawing from the Net-Zero Banking Alliance; Zopa Bank, one of the earliest UK fintechs, announcing it has recently raised £68M in an equity round; Aviva, the UK’s largest insurer, reaching a preliminary agreement to acquire rival Direct Line for £3.6bn; and Vanguard spinning off its $900 billion wealth and advice segment into a standalone unit.This week's guests: Baard Slaattelid - Director, Strategic Payment Partnerships at Vipps MobilePay  Hannah Duncan - Award winning freelance writer  Matthew Jones - Head of Ventures at Transverse Plus soundbite from: Steve Hulme - CFO of Zopa BankStories covered on the show:Norway’s Vipps launches world’s first Apple Pay rival for iPhoneGoldman decides to leave world’s top climate alliance for banksZopa Bank hunts for fintech acquisitions after £68 million fundraise Direct Line accepts £3.6bn takeover after rival insurer Aviva raises bidVanguard revamps $900bn unit to speed up investment I gave my kids £300 to see what they would do with it_ _This episode is sponsored by Finimize for Business, click here to find out more_ _Join our WhatsApp community, where you can get the inside track on all all things 11:FS, as well as having your say on the things we should be paying attention to.https://chat.whatsapp.com/KpA4gFbbWDlLFm7kx39rafFintech Insider by 11:FS is a bi-weekly podcast dedicated to all things finance, banking, technology, and financial services.Our expert hosts, with real industry experience, are joined by the biggest decision-makers, VCs, and reporters from across financial services including guests from Visa, Nubank, M-Pesa, Starling, and JP Morgan Chase to discuss the latest news, developments, and trends within the industry.Our weekly news show drops every Monday and tackles the biggest news stories, from acquisitions and launches, to regulatory changes and innovation. 921. News: What does Australia's under-16 social media ban mean for financial services?

In this discussion, Jasper Martens, CMO at PensionBee, Tomás Herrmann, UK GM at Bunch, and Simone Joyce, CEO of Paypa Plane, dive into Australia's new social media ban for under-16s and its potential impact on financial services. They dissect the alarming increase in financial scams targeting minors and the need for stricter advertising regulations. Additionally, the insights on Bunch's UK launch highlight innovations in private equity and the expanding opportunities for fintech in Francophone Africa with HUB2's recent funding capture. 919. News: UK lenders brace for massive payouts and is the FCA 'incompetent'?

Javed Anjum, CEO of OneBanks, Matthew Williamson, a partner at Thistle Initiatives, and Selma Piper, founder of Fintech Fiends, dive into major fintech headlines. They discuss a shocking report criticizing the UK's Financial Conduct Authority as unfit and the implications for consumer protection. The group also examines UniCredit's bid for Banco BPM, addressing the complexities of banking mergers. Plus, Checkout.com's expansion into Japan reveals the challenges of adapting to new markets, highlighting cultural differences and the demand for innovation in financial services.

916. Insights: How fintech can fight back against the fraudsters

Ilya Brovin, Chief Growth Officer at SumSub, Vinita Ramtri, Senior Fin Crime Leader at a UK challenger bank, and Dave Laramy, SVP at Danske Bank, discuss the rising trend of fraud in fintech. They highlight the complexities of fraud in the digital age, driven by AI and blockchain advancements. The trio emphasizes the importance of collaboration among banks and law enforcement for effective fraud prevention. They also cover the implications of UK regulations shifting the responsibility of fraud prevention back to organizations, urging for enhanced transparency and accountability.

915. News: LATAM fintech is booming, Metrobank slapped with a hefty fine, and why Klarna chose NYC for its IPO

Miguel Armaza, co-founder at Gilgamesh Ventures and host of the Fintech Leaders Podcast, joins Valentina Kristensen, Corporate Affairs Director at OakNorth. They explore the thriving LATAM fintech scene, with Nubank hitting 100 million customers and Ualá securing new funding. Klarna's decision to IPO in the U.S. is dissected, alongside Metrobank's hefty fine for compliance failures. The importance of financial education for children, championed by GoHenry, rounds out the discussion, emphasizing the need for early money management skills.
